Space-filling curves in adaptive curvilinear coordinates for computer numerically controlled five-axis machining

S.S. Makhanov

Mathematics and Computers in Simulation (MATCOM), 2009, vol. 79, issue 8, 2385-2402

Abstract: The paper presents a concatenation of two methods for optimization of five-axis machining proposed earlier by the author. The first method is based on the grid generation techniques whereas the second method exploits the space filling curve technologies. Combination of the two techniques is superior with regard to the conventional methods and with regard to the case when the two methods are applied independently.
